Moneasa weather in July (Arad, Romania)
Looking to travel to Moneasa in July? Check out this comprehensive weather guide.
In July, Moneasa typically experiences high temperatures and high rainfall. July is a summer month. Daytime temperatures hover around 27°C, while nights can cool down to about 14°C.
Moneasa in July usually receives high rainfall, averaging around 105 mm for the month. Delving into the climate records from the past 30 years, one can predict that nearly 11 days of the month will see rainfall.
With around 282 hours of sunshine, the days are mostly sunny. It gives a pleasant and vibrant feel to the area.
If you prefer dry days with pleasant temperatures, August and September typically offer the best circumstances. While January, February and December tend to showcase less optimal conditions.

So, what should you wear in Moneasa in July?
It's going to be warm! Consider airy clothing, t-shirts, and other summer clothes. Shorts for men made of cotton or linen are good options for staying cool. However, there's a good chance of rain, so bring a raincoat just in case.What To Do
